Roofing Infographic Link Building Defined (Google-Friendly Definition)

Roofing infographic link building is the process of publishing roofing-related visual content using verified data, then distributing those visuals to relevant websites so they embed the graphics and link back to the roofer’s website as the source.

Key components:

ComponentSEO Purpose
Infographic (visual content)Creates shareability + embed portability
Verified factual dataEstablishes expertise and trust
Content hub pageCaptures PageRank from earned links
Outreach and digital PRExpands link acquisition opportunities
Local relevanceImproves ranking in local service areas

Google interprets this as earned media, one of the highest-quality backlink types.

Roofing Infographic Topic Library (Topical Authority Expansion)

Each of these topics connects to roofing-specific user intent, seasonal demand, and link-worthy triggers.

Weather Damage and Local Risk

• Hail damage detection chart
• Storm season timeline by U.S. state
• Roof wind-resistance comparison

Local angle:
“Hail Damage Risk Map: Dallas-Fort Worth Roofing”

Insurance Claims and Homeowner Guidance

• Insurance claim decision flowchart
• Covered vs. non-covered roof damage
• Replacement timelines per insurer type

Local angle:
“Florida Homeowner Insurance Roof Policy Updates (Updated 2025)”

Cost, ROI, and Energy Efficiency

• Residential roofing cost breakdown by material
• Solar shingle ROI vs. traditional roofing
• Heat-map comparing attic insulation vs. roof lifespan

Safety, Codes, and Compliance

• Ladder safety + OSHA statistics
• Local code upgrade requirements by county
• Fire-resistant roofing materials

Roof Maintenance & Lifespan Education

• Annual roof maintenance calendar
• Roof lifespan chart by climate region
• Gutter system effect on shingle longevity

These are data-verified topics that journalists source heavily during storm, insurance, and seasonal cycles.

Creating Roofing Infographics That Google Values

Google’s systems must understand:

  1. The data’s origin
  2. The expert who validated it
  3. The location relevance
  4. The visual object relationships

Therefore:

Design Rules

• Include your company logo, NAP signals, and website
• Ensure text readability for image indexing
• Add image alt text describing the full dataset
• Add structured markup supporting image understanding

Data Integrity Rules

Use trusted governing sources:

• National Roofing Contractors Association
• FEMA Resiliency Data
• NOAA Severe Weather Database
• IBHS Impact Reports
• Local building permit documents
• Manufacturer load/warranty specifications

This protects E-E-A-T trust and increases the likelihood of authoritative backlinks.

Roofing Infographic Outreach Strategy That Produces Guaranteed Links

The strategy has 3 phases, and each phase has a clear job:

Phase 1 — Publish a Content Hub Page

(Where backlinks will point to)

You host the infographic on your website, on a dedicated blog page.

This page must include:

  1. The infographic
  2. A written explanation of everything inside the infographic
  3. A download button (for the infographic as a file)
  4. An embed code so other websites can easily copy + paste it
  5. A clear publishing date and update schedule
    (This shows accuracy, E-E-A-T, and keeps the page “fresh” for rankings)

This hub page is the PageRank catcher — the center of your link building strategy.

All backlinks earned from outreach will point to this page.

Phase 2 — Multi-Sector Outreach

(Where backlinks are acquired)

Instead of only emailing one type of website, you simultaneously reach out to 5 different publisher categories:

ClusterWhy They Would Link to You
Local NewsThey cover storms, roof issues, safety alerts
HOAs & Property ManagersThey educate homeowners in their community
Insurance AgentsThey need claim-related homeowner guides
Home Improvement PublishersThey want expert visual content
Colleges & Local Resource PagesThey promote public safety and education

This increases outreach success because:

• Every cluster has different motivations
• Not all will respond at the same time
• It produces diverse types of authority backlinks
(journalistic authority + local authority + topical authority)

This is also why Google sees your company as a real entity, not just a business pushing sales pages.

Partnerships with homeowner associations and nonprofit groups align perfectly with roofing sponsorship and community link strategies, because they value educational resources they can share with residents.

Phase 3 — Re-Syndication Opportunities

(Expanding reach and getting additional links without new content)

You take one infographic and turn it into 4–6 other content formats:

Example transformations:

FormatWhere It Gets PostedLink Benefit
CarouselsFacebook, Instagram, LinkedInSocial citations + brand awareness
Short-form videosTikTok, YouTube Shorts, ReelsEmbed and follow links
Safety guidesHOA newsletters, city sitesCivic backlinks
PR pitch sheetLocal newsroomsEarn media backlinks

Email Outreach Template for Roofers

Subject:
Storm Damage Risk Visual Guide for Your Local Readers

Body:
Hello [Name],
We created a homeowner-focused infographic that visually explains how hail impacts roofs in [City/Region] and how to identify early warning signs before leaks occur. It references data from FEMA and IBHS and was validated by certified roofing professionals.

If your publication finds this useful, here is the embed code with full attributions:

[Embed Code Here]

Let me know if you’d like a localized version specifically for your audience.

Thank you,
[Name]
[Roofing Company]
[Website]

This offer contains editorial value, not a sales pitch.

Tracking Link Quality and SEO Results

Not all backlinks contribute equally.

Prioritize:

FactorWhy It Matters
Local site relevanceStrongest geo-ranking impact
Editorial context + placementAnchor surrounding text validates topic
Authority of root domainPageRank transfer multiplier
Permanent embeds vs. nofollowLong-term equity vs. temporary mention

Monitor:

• New linking root domains
• Referral conversions
• Organic visibility improvements
• GMB interaction increases in target ZIP codes

Successful infographics have a compounding ROI effect.

Scaling Roadmap: 12-Month Infographic Link Building Calendar

QuarterPrimary TopicSeasonal ReasonExpected Link Targets
Q1Annual Roof Inspection GuideNew year maintenanceLocal news, HOAs
Q2Storm Damage IdentificationPeak hail seasonWeather publishers
Q3Roof Energy Efficiency & Heat MappingSummer heatGreen-energy bloggers
Q4Insurance Claims RoadmapPolicy renewal periodInsurance industry

This is predictable, scalable, and authority-building.

SEO Technical Checklist for Infographics

RequirementTechnical Purpose
Unique file name with keywordsImproves image indexation
alt text describing dataNLP comprehension
WebP + SVG versionsPage speed + rendering clarity
JSON-LD markupEntity
EXIF removalBrand control

Every infographic must include a captioned data explanation for Google’s multimodal systems.
